TY 1415 (KALMAEGI)
Issued at 09:45 UTC, 13 September 2014

<Analyses at 13/09 UTC>
Scale -
Intensity Strong
Center position N14°35'(14.6°)
E126°40'(126.7°)
Direction and speed of movement W 25km/h(14kt)
Central pressure 975hPa
Maximum wind speed near the center 35m/s(65kt)
Maximum wind gust speed 50m/s(95kt)
Area of 50kt winds or more ALL90km(50NM)
Area of 30kt winds or more S330km(180NM)
N220km(120NM)

<Forecast for 13/21 UTC>
Intensity Strong
Center position of probability circle N15°20'(15.3°)
E125°00'(125.0°)
Direction and speed of movement WNW 20km/h(10kt)
Central pressure 970hPa
Maximum wind speed near the center 35m/s(65kt)
Maximum wind gust speed 50m/s(95kt)
Radius of probability circle 90km(50NM)
Storm warning area ALL200km(110NM)

<Forecast for 14/09 UTC>
Intensity Strong
Center position of probability circle N16°35'(16.6°)
E122°50'(122.8°)
Direction and speed of movement WNW 20km/h(12kt)
Central pressure 965hPa
Maximum wind speed near the center 35m/s(70kt)
Maximum wind gust speed 50m/s(100kt)
Radius of probability circle 140km(75NM)
Storm warning area ALL280km(150NM)

<Forecast for 15/06 UTC>
Intensity Strong
Center position of probability circle N18°25'(18.4°)
E117°40'(117.7°)
Direction and speed of movement WNW 25km/h(14kt)
Central pressure 970hPa
Maximum wind speed near the center 35m/s(65kt)
Maximum wind gust speed 50m/s(95kt)
Radius of probability circle 260km(140NM)
Storm warning area ALL390km(210NM)

<Forecast for 16/06 UTC>
Intensity Strong
Center position of probability circle N19°50'(19.8°)
E112°00'(112.0°)
Direction and speed of movement WNW 25km/h(14kt)
Central pressure 965hPa
Maximum wind speed near the center 35m/s(70kt)
Maximum wind gust speed 50m/s(100kt)
Radius of probability circle 390km(210NM)
Storm warning area ALL540km(290NM)

Latest warning from JTWC has TS winds for much of Luzon in pink, Manila isn't out of the cone yet...

Image

Closer look at the projected landfall east of Palanan shows a very sparesly populated area...

Image

The Sierra Madre Mountains of eastern Luzon can act like a shield but can also produce torrential flooding which can kill alot of people...
